CAF means cafeteria plan. A cafeteria plan is a written plan set up by an employer for employees according to Section 125 of the IRS Code. This plan is set up to offer employees a choice between taxable and qualified benefits. A qualified benefit includes adoption assistance, dependent care assistance, group-term life insurance coverage, etc.

What does line 12b represent on a W-2 tax form?

Box 12 on a W-2 form contains information that is usually relavent to your tax return. Included in this box are pre-tax insurance plan payments, cafeteria plans, pre-tax funds placed into 401K, 403b, and such tax deferred plans, housing allowances for clergy or military personnel, third party sick pay, and many other items that may qualify to be in this Box. What do you put on a tax form if your parents are claiming you as a dependent?

There's a box that's checked on Form 1040EZ in line 5 if you're filing your own tax return and your parents are claiming you as a dependent. But you leave the box blank (unchecked) if you're using Form 1040A or Form 1040. On those two forms, it's the box on line 6a and it's stated "If someone can claim you as a dependent, do not check box 6a." The point of indicating on your tax return that your parents are claiming you as a dependent is to make sure that you don't take an exemption for yourself, because your parents are claiming your exemption on their return.
